Damages That Are Caused By Fire & Water That Will Need Repair

Fire damage can sometimes have additional dangerous consequences. For instance, materials containing lead or asbestos can pose serious health implications and need to be handled by qualified experts. Other substances can also emit poisonous fumes if exposed to fire.

Some Basic Advice On What To Do After Getting Fire Or Water Damage In Olympia WA

Take whatever steps that are necessary to prevent any further or secondary damage, without exposing your personal security. Notify your insurance company as soon as possible and before you try any cleaning up. It may be wise to turn off your water, gas and electricity for safety reasons and limit any possible further damage. Water & Fire Damage Restoration Insurance Claims Advice

Creating a checklist is a very good way of ensuring that you do not miss any damages from your insurance claim. Inspect every room in your property and note any damage items you can find. It's not just damaged belongings such as furniture, curtains, clothes etc that you should list. Remember to check your floors, ceilings and walls for damage as well.

Practical Steps To Protect Against Flooding

Going on vacation and coming back to a water damaged house can instantly wipe away your happy holiday memories. Before you go away, make sure that you have turned off your main water supply to the house. If you live in a state where winter temperatures get very low then there is always a risk of pipes freezing. Set your thermostat low but enough to prevent this happening. Also you can ask a neighbor or friends to periodically check your home.

Practical Fire Prevention Tips

All heating appliances are a potential risk to starting fires in the home. e.g. open flame heaters and electric heaters. This is especially the case where open flames are involved. Take care not to leave any flammable products close to heating appliances. You are at most risk during the cold winter months when you need to keep warm. Sparks from burning wood fires pose a real danger.
